I read this book after reading Kay Hooper's "Shadow" and "Evil" books and considering that those books were written well after "After Caroline," one might think that this novel might not hold up, but one would be wrong. "Caroline is every bit the book Hooper's later works are. I was hooked from the first page. Yes, there was an awful lot of coincidence, two accidents, one near fatal, one fatal, that take place at the same time to identical women who are the same age, but that's okay, because Hooper deals with it in a way that makes us believe. She pulls us into the story with suspense, romance and richly drawn characters.
I liked this book four stars worth and would highly recommend it to anyone who loves good romance, good suspense and a touch of the strange.
